Commit graph

191 commits

Author SHA1 Message Date
Tobias C. Berner
da6bf65c95 games/freeciv: prepare for Qt5-5.15 2020-05-21 07:34:54 +00:00
Tobias Kortkamp
d3171fdc96 games/freeciv: Update to 2.6.2
Changes:	https://freeciv.fandom.com/wiki/NEWS-2.6.2
2020-02-16 06:05:22 +00:00
Tobias Kortkamp
fb4303de40 games/freeciv: Pet portfmt 2020-02-16 06:04:37 +00:00
Tobias Kortkamp
c67070a64e games/freeciv: Update to 2.6.1
Changes:	https://freeciv.fandom.com/wiki/NEWS-2.6.1
2019-12-19 06:12:35 +00:00
Gerald Pfeifer
ea8c8ec7da Bump PORTREVISION for ports depending on the canonical version of GCC
as defined in Mk/bsd.default-versions.mk which has moved from GCC 8.3
to GCC 9.1 under most circumstances now after revision 507371.

This includes ports
 - with USE_GCC=yes or USE_GCC=any,
 - with USES=fortran,
 - using Mk/bsd.octave.mk which in turn features USES=fortran, and
 - with USES=compiler specifying openmp, nestedfct, c11, c++0x, c++11-lang,
   c++11-lib, c++14-lang, c++17-lang, or gcc-c++11-lib
plus, everything INDEX-11 shows with a dependency on lang/gcc9 now.

PR:		238330
2019-07-26 20:46:53 +00:00
Tobias Kortkamp
4c948f2cb8 games/freeciv: Update to 2.6.0
- Add options to allow building of more of the various clients.
  For now just enable the Qt client by default.

Changes:	https://freeciv.fandom.com/wiki/NEWS-2.6.0
2019-06-21 08:25:49 +00:00
Tobias Kortkamp
a9c5c43234 games/freeciv: Remove games/ggz-gtk-client dependency and unlock build on 13.0
ggz-gtk-client currently fails to build on 13.0.  ggz-gtk-client
seems to be abandoned upstream and fixing it might not be worthwhile.
Freeciv does not really need it, so remove the dependency on it.

Also take maintainership.

PR:		238256
Approved by:	johans (maintainer timeout, 2 weeks)
2019-06-15 07:42:42 +00:00
Tobias Kortkamp
5e24d00a42 games/freeciv: Spell IPV6_CONFIGURE_ENABLE correctly 2019-04-16 18:34:25 +00:00
Sunpoet Po-Chuan Hsieh
40c9c7f7eb Update devel/readline to 8.0
- Bump PORTREVISION of dependent ports for shlib change

Changes:	https://tiswww.case.edu/php/chet/readline/CHANGES
PR:		236156
Exp-run by:	antoine
2019-04-09 14:04:49 +00:00
Dmitry Marakasov
c1397f808a - Update sdl_gfx to 2.0.26, bump dependent ports due to shared library version change 2019-01-30 12:36:36 +00:00
Johan van Selst
d5b663c050 Update FreeCiv to 2.5.10 (bugfix release) 2018-02-05 13:07:34 +00:00
Johan van Selst
9f2e83038b Update to FreeCiv 2.5.9 (bugfix release) 2017-12-13 16:24:21 +00:00
Johan van Selst
e63f9a4881 Update to Freeciv 2.5.7 (minor bugfix release) 2017-07-05 20:38:02 +00:00
Sunpoet Po-Chuan Hsieh
cb037d3c98 Update devel/readline to 7.0 patch 3
- Bump PORTREVISION for shlib change

Changes:	https://cnswww.cns.cwru.edu/php/chet/readline/CHANGES
		https://lists.gnu.org/archive/html/bug-bash/2016-09/msg00107.html
		https://lists.gnu.org/archive/html/bug-readline/2017-01/msg00002.html
Differential Revision:	https://reviews.freebsd.org/D11172
PR:		219947
Exp-run by:	antoine
2017-06-27 13:46:53 +00:00
Sunpoet Po-Chuan Hsieh
6fbb7d9609 Fix options helper
- Fix OPTIONS_DEFAULT: remove IPV6 and NLS which are added by framework
- Convert to options target helper

Approved by:	portmgr (blanket)
2017-05-28 23:17:24 +00:00
Johan van Selst
661c284713 Simplify using USES=localbase (no functional change)
Reported by:	danfe
2016-12-27 20:53:27 +00:00
Johan van Selst
81adb126bc Update to FreeCiv 2.5.6 (bugfix release)
correct NLS option
2016-12-27 10:09:34 +00:00
Johan van Selst
41424bdc52 Minor cleanup (no functional change)
Reported by:	marino
2016-08-01 19:36:24 +00:00
Johan van Selst
ffd7d46acd - Update to FreeCiv 2.5.5 (bugfix release)
- make hidden dependencies explicit
2016-07-31 20:48:58 +00:00
Dmitry Marakasov
4e942b6419 - Fix trailing whitespace in pkg-descrs, categories [g-n]*
Approved by:	portmgr blanket
2016-05-19 10:44:11 +00:00
Johan van Selst
f4d2731695 Update to FreeCiv 2.5.4 (bugfix release) 2016-05-14 16:08:09 +00:00
Mathieu Arnold
4e1b79a0a6 Remove ${PORTSDIR}/ from dependencies, categories d, e, f, and g.
With hat:	portmgr
Sponsored by:	Absolight
2016-04-01 14:00:51 +00:00
Johan van Selst
e1d3e1fc95 Update FreeCiv to 2.5.3 (bugfix release) 2016-02-07 14:51:53 +00:00
Johan van Selst
82051c765a Update to FreeCiv 2.5.2 (bugfix release) 2016-01-20 20:47:39 +00:00
Baptiste Daroussin
ac922c592e Convert g* and i* to USES=sqlite and USES=firebird 2016-01-10 16:55:26 +00:00
Johan van Selst
1fac2476d9 Update to FreeCiv 2.5.1 (bugfix release) 2015-08-15 18:59:05 +00:00
Johan van Selst
7af9c89cf8 Fix build without X11 2015-03-21 19:55:25 +00:00
Johan van Selst
59bfc99229 Update to FreeCiv 2.5.0
http://freeciv.wikia.com/wiki/NEWS-2.5.0
2015-03-17 18:35:01 +00:00
Baptiste Daroussin
bb21093773 Bump portrevision after png update 2014-12-25 20:54:41 +00:00
Antoine Brodin
7ae46e9b12 Change libpng15.so to libpng.so in LIB_DEPENDS to prepare the upgrade 2014-12-25 19:04:25 +00:00
Tijl Coosemans
60945f0277 Replace USES=libtool:oldver with USES=libtool or USES=libtool:keepla in
the 32 ports that still use it.  Bump PORTREVISION on their dependent
ports except the ones that depend on these:

audio/libogg
audio/libvorbis
devel/pcre
ftp/curl
graphics/jpeg
graphics/libart_lgpl
graphics/tiff
textproc/expat2
textproc/libxslt

In these cases the same trick as in the recent gettext update is used.
The ports install a symlink with the old library version.  When enough
of their dependent ports have had regular updates the remaining ones can
get a PORTREVISION bump and the links can be removed.

Also remove the devel/pcre dependency from USE_GNOME=glib20.  It causes
over 2200 packages to depend on devel/pcre while less than 200 actually
link with it.  The glib20 package still depends on devel/pcre so this
should not make a difference for ports with USE_GNOME=glib20.  Also,
libdata/pkgconfig/glib-2.0.pc lists pcre as a private library so
USE_GNOME=glib20 should not propagate it.

PR:		195724
Exp-run by:	antoine
Approved by:	portmgr (antoine)
2014-12-08 16:48:38 +00:00
Johan van Selst
2689d4e478 Update to Freeciv 2.4.4 (bugfix release)
http://freeciv.wikia.com/wiki/NEWS-2.4.4
2014-12-07 10:57:57 +00:00
Dmitry Marakasov
a810686914 - Fix etc/ggz.modules handling
- Remove @dirrm* from plist

PR:		193515 [1]
Submitted by:	amdmi3
Approved by:	portmgr blanket
Approved by:	maintainer timeout ([1])
2014-12-03 13:39:28 +00:00
Tijl Coosemans
15c4a5ecf3 Replace USE_AUTOTOOLS=libltdl with an ordinary LIB_DEPENDS in all ports.
There are only 60 such ports so there doesn't need to be a separate
keyword or USES for this.

Approved by:	portmgr (bapt)
2014-09-17 07:38:15 +00:00
Gerald Pfeifer
15945f8122 Update the default version of GCC in the Ports Collection from GCC 4.7.4
to GCC 4.8.3.

Part II, Bump PORTREVISIONs.

PR:		192025
Tested by:	antoine (-exp runs)
Approved by:	portmgr (implicit)
2014-09-10 20:50:31 +00:00
Dmitry Marakasov
9f2cd74f43 - Drop .la files for games/libggz, no dependees require them
- Bump dependent ports as .so version has changed

Approved by:	portmgr blanket
2014-09-10 12:17:23 +00:00
Johan van Selst
9ab79e0ae2 Update to FreeCiv 2.4.3 (mostly bugfix-release)
http://www.freeciv.org/wiki/NEWS-2.4.3
2014-08-13 08:46:13 +00:00
Adam Weinberger
bdeb856151 Add DOCS to OPTIONS for ports that have PORTDOCS in the plist. 2014-07-15 23:30:05 +00:00
Tijl Coosemans
a5185846f0 Bump PORTREVISION on all ports with USE_SQLITE=yes or USE_SQLITE=3 that
have not been bumped yet after the latest libsqlite3.so library version
change.

Approved by:	portmgr (implicit)
2014-07-04 09:40:59 +00:00
Dmitry Marakasov
de745b7c09 - Drop :oldver from USES=libtool, no dependent ports require .la files
- Bump dependent port (games/freeciv) as .so version has changed

Approved by:	portmgr blanket
2014-06-20 11:22:43 +00:00
Dmitry Marakasov
388783780a - Convert USE_BZIP2 to USES
- Switch to USES=libtool, drop .la files

Approved by:	portmgr blanket
2014-06-20 11:20:06 +00:00
Antoine Brodin
3e9abce16c Fix plist without X11.
This change + r344393 should unbreak games/freeciv-nox11

Reported by:	pkg-fallout
2014-02-15 14:40:46 +00:00
Johan van Selst
d0f45ab36d Update to FreeCiv 2.4.2 2014-02-08 23:31:37 +00:00
Johan van Selst
9d5aa29f62 - Correct dependencies [1,2]
- Update to FreeCiv 2.4.1 [3]

PR:		ports/185235 [2]
Submitted by:	Alexandr Matveev <timon@timon.net.nz> [1], John Marino <freebsd@marino.st> [2]
2013-12-28 09:10:11 +00:00
Dmitry Marakasov
c87a56b351 - Remove manual creation and removal of share/applications, as it's now in the mtree (games category)
Approved by:	portmgr (bdrewery)
2013-10-22 13:53:33 +00:00
Johan van Selst
b83aa176bd - Add missing dependency
- Bump PORTREVISION

Submitted by:	Michael Jochimsen <mlj@troglodytics.org>
2013-10-12 20:47:03 +00:00
Johan van Selst
c68f700f6a - Update to 2.4.0
- Enable stage support
2013-10-06 10:14:04 +00:00
Baptiste Daroussin
d8352fb86c Do not arbitrary rename packages 2013-10-04 08:52:32 +00:00
Baptiste Daroussin
c84e1cd8e6 Add NO_STAGE all over the place in preparation for the staging support (cat: games) 2013-09-20 17:36:33 +00:00
Baptiste Daroussin
153173f66a Fix build on head 2013-09-13 13:59:02 +00:00